The volume of a cylinder is 539 cm cube and the circumference of the base is 22 cm. find the height of the cylinder.

Answer:

Aproximated height is:

14 cm

Explanation:

volume of a cylinder = л r² h

л = 3.1416 (aprox)

r = radius

h = height

r = circunference/2л

r = 22/(2*3.1416)

r = 3.5 (aprox)

then volume is:

539 = 3.1416 * 3.5² * h

539 = 3.1416 * 12.25 * h

539 = 38.5 * h

h = 539/38.5

h = 14 cm (aprox)
